Three Premier League players suspended

20110417-114224.jpgAngus Buhagiar of Naxxar Lions was banned for two matches while Fabio Vignaroli (Balzan) and Kane Paul Farrugia (Mosta) were banned for one match by the MFA Disciplinary Commissioner following the weekend’s matches.

Buhagiar is ruled out of the games against Valletta and Mosta while Vignaroli and Farrugia are ruled out of this weekend’s clash between Balzan and Mosta.

Mosta team manager Adrian Farrugia was also banned for two matches.

In Division 1, Ivan Casha (Birzebbuga) was suspended for one match.

Gilbert Camilleri (Mellieha) was suspended for two matches in Division 2 while Karl Grech (Mdina) and Jonathan Grech (St. Patrick) were banned for one match.

Christian Gafa (Marsaxlokk), Jonathan Muscat (Mgarr) and Christian Bugeja (Sta. Lucia) were handed a one-match ban in Division 3.

Kurt Formosa (Senglea) and Fabian Baldacchino (Marsaxlokk) were suspended for not having a valid medical certificate.
